暗号資産(仮想通貨)のマルチシグウォレットのメリットと設定法



暗号資産(仮想通貨)のマルチシグウォレットのメリットと設定法


暗号資産(仮想通貨)のマルチシグウォレットのメリットと設定法

暗号資産(仮想通貨)の普及に伴い、そのセキュリティ対策の重要性が増しています。特に、大量の暗号資産を保有する個人や企業にとっては、単一の秘密鍵による管理方法ではリスクが高すぎると言えます。そこで注目されているのが、マルチシグウォレット(Multi-Signature Wallet)です。本稿では、マルチシグウォレットのメリット、仕組み、設定方法について詳細に解説します。

1. マルチシグウォレットとは

マルチシグウォレットとは、暗号資産の送金や取引に複数の署名(シグネチャ)を必要とするウォレットのことです。従来のウォレットは、単一の秘密鍵によって管理されますが、マルチシグウォレットでは、複数の秘密鍵と、それらを組み合わせるためのルール(m-of-nルール)が設定されます。m-of-nルールとは、「n個の秘密鍵のうち、m個以上の署名があれば取引を承認する」というルールです。例えば、2-of-3ルールの場合、3つの秘密鍵のうち2つ以上の署名が必要になります。

2. マルチシグウォレットのメリット

2.1 セキュリティの向上

マルチシグウォレットの最大のメリットは、セキュリティの向上です。単一の秘密鍵が漏洩した場合でも、他の秘密鍵が安全であれば、資産を保護することができます。また、内部不正のリスクを軽減することも可能です。例えば、企業がマルチシグウォレットを使用する場合、複数の担当者が秘密鍵を管理することで、単独の担当者による不正な送金を防ぐことができます。

2.2 資産の分散管理

マルチシグウォレットを使用することで、資産を複数の場所に分散して管理することができます。これにより、単一の場所に資産が集中するリスクを軽減し、災害やハッキングなどのリスクに備えることができます。例えば、複数の国にいる担当者がそれぞれ秘密鍵を管理することで、地理的なリスクを分散することができます。

2.3 共同管理の実現

マルチシグウォレットは、複数の関係者による共同管理を可能にします。例えば、家族間で暗号資産を共有する場合、それぞれの家族が秘密鍵を管理することで、共同で資産を管理することができます。また、企業が複数の部門で暗号資産を使用する場合、それぞれの部門が秘密鍵を管理することで、部門間の連携を強化することができます。

2.4 遺産相続への対応

マルチシグウォレットは、遺産相続への対応を容易にします。例えば、遺産相続人が複数の場合、それぞれの相続人が秘密鍵を管理することで、共同で資産を相続することができます。また、遺言書に秘密鍵の情報を記載しておくことで、相続手続きをスムーズに進めることができます。

3. マルチシグウォレットの仕組み

マルチシグウォレットの仕組みは、公開鍵暗号方式に基づいています。各秘密鍵に対応する公開鍵が存在し、取引の署名にはこれらの公開鍵が使用されます。取引を行う際には、m個の秘密鍵を持つユーザーがそれぞれ署名を行い、それらの署名を組み合わせて取引を承認します。このプロセスにより、単一の秘密鍵だけでは取引を完了することができません。

3.1 公開鍵と秘密鍵

公開鍵暗号方式では、公開鍵と秘密鍵のペアが使用されます。公開鍵は誰でも入手できますが、秘密鍵は所有者だけが知っています。公開鍵は、暗号化や署名の検証に使用され、秘密鍵は、復号や署名の生成に使用されます。マルチシグウォレットでは、複数の秘密鍵と、それに対応する公開鍵が使用されます。

3.2 m-of-nルール

m-of-nルールは、マルチシグウォレットの重要な要素です。このルールによって、取引を承認するために必要な署名の数を決定します。例えば、2-of-3ルールの場合、3つの秘密鍵のうち2つ以上の署名が必要になります。mの値が大きくなるほど、セキュリティは向上しますが、取引の承認が難しくなります。逆に、mの値が小さくなるほど、取引の承認は容易になりますが、セキュリティは低下します。

3.3 ウォレットの作成と設定

マルチシグウォレットを作成するには、専用のソフトウェアやサービスを使用します。これらのソフトウェアやサービスは、秘密鍵の生成、公開鍵の交換、m-of-nルールの設定などの機能を提供します。ウォレットを作成する際には、秘密鍵を安全に保管することが重要です。秘密鍵を紛失した場合、資産を失う可能性があります。

4. マルチシグウォレットの設定方法

マルチシグウォレットの設定方法は、使用するソフトウェアやサービスによって異なりますが、一般的な手順は以下の通りです。

4.1 ウォレットの選択

まず、使用するマルチシグウォレットを選択します。BitGo、Electrum、Casaなどのソフトウェアやサービスが利用可能です。それぞれのウォレットの特徴や機能、セキュリティレベルなどを比較検討し、自分のニーズに合ったウォレットを選択します。

4.2 秘密鍵の生成

次に、必要な数の秘密鍵を生成します。例えば、2-of-3ルールの場合、3つの秘密鍵を生成します。秘密鍵は、安全な場所に保管することが重要です。ハードウェアウォレットを使用したり、オフラインで保管したりするなど、適切な方法で秘密鍵を保護します。

4.3 公開鍵の交換

生成した秘密鍵に対応する公開鍵を、他の署名者に交換します。公開鍵は、安全な通信手段を使用して交換する必要があります。例えば、メールやチャットではなく、対面で交換したり、暗号化された通信手段を使用したりします。

4.4 m-of-nルールの設定

最後に、m-of-nルールを設定します。例えば、2-of-3ルールを設定する場合、3つの秘密鍵のうち2つ以上の署名が必要になるように設定します。mの値とnの値は、セキュリティと利便性のバランスを考慮して決定します。

4.5 ウォレットのアドレスの確認

設定が完了したら、ウォレットのアドレスを確認します。このアドレスは、暗号資産を送金する際に使用します。アドレスを間違えると、資産を失う可能性がありますので、注意が必要です。

5. マルチシグウォレットの注意点

5.1 秘密鍵の管理

マルチシグウォレットを使用する上で最も重要なことは、秘密鍵の管理です。秘密鍵を紛失した場合、資産を失う可能性があります。秘密鍵は、安全な場所に保管し、定期的にバックアップを作成することが重要です。

5.2 署名者の選定

マルチシグウォレットの署名者は、信頼できる人物や組織を選ぶ必要があります。署名者が不正な行為を行った場合、資産を失う可能性があります。署名者の選定には、十分な注意が必要です。

5.3 取引手数料

マルチシグウォレットを使用すると、取引手数料が高くなる場合があります。これは、複数の署名が必要となるため、取引の処理に時間がかかるためです。取引手数料を考慮して、マルチシグウォレットを使用するかどうかを検討する必要があります。

5.4 ソフトウェアの選択

マルチシグウォレットをサポートするソフトウェアは、信頼できる開発元が提供しているものを選ぶ必要があります。セキュリティ上の脆弱性があるソフトウェアを使用すると、資産を失う可能性があります。ソフトウェアの選択には、十分な注意が必要です。

6. まとめ

マルチシグウォレットは、暗号資産のセキュリティを向上させ、資産の分散管理や共同管理を実現するための有効な手段です。しかし、秘密鍵の管理や署名者の選定など、注意すべき点も存在します。マルチシグウォレットを導入する際には、これらの点を十分に理解し、適切な設定を行うことが重要です。暗号資産の安全な管理のために、マルチシグウォレットの活用を検討してみてはいかがでしょうか。


前の記事

これから伸びる仮想通貨!テゾス(XTZ)を見逃すな!

次の記事

ペペ(PEPE)アート作品集!個性あふれる創作例